Chapel of the Cart Wheel @ Hacienda Sta Rosalia, Manapla, Negros Occidental

This Chapel is located inside Hacienda Sta Rosalia. It is made of Recycled Materials. Old Wheels, Old Wood from Demolished houses, etc. It also has a stained glass window made from Broken Glass Pieces from Old Bottles. 

This chapel is a recent addition to the Hacienda. It was built in the 1960's by Father Gigi Gaston (If I am not mistaken). The First Mass in Hiligaynon was first celebrated here by Father Gigi Gaston, he is also the current occupant of the Gaston Mansion. 

The Chapel is open to the public and Masses are held there every sunday.
